"Jesse Myers, the head of Bitcoin strategy at Moon Inc., has predicted that companies could own half of all Bitcoin by 2045. This would mean that companies would hold around 10.5 million coins, worth around $348.25 billion at today's price. Myers believes that this shift will be driven by the growth of 'Bitcoin Treasury Companies' that will hold large amounts of Bitcoin as a store of value. He also notes that there is currently $1,000 trillion in assets across the world, and that even a small percentage of this could flow into digital currency over time."
